Lewiston Adult Ed registration is open

LEWISTON – Registration for all winter-spring courses is open at Lewiston Adult Education.

LAE has fresh and updated computer technology and job skills classes for those looking to enhance their skills for current or future jobs.

Certificate courses will also be available towards LAE’s accounting assistant, clerical, culinary arts, medical office and welding certificates, in addition to the certified nursing assistant course.

High school diploma and college transitions courses will also be available through LAE.

Contact Elayne Bean at 795-4141 for more information on academic or college prep coursework.

GED prep and testing, citizenship classes and ESOL courses are also available at the Adult Learning Center. Contact Anne Kemper at 784-2928, ext. 2, for more information.

LAE will have a variety of new and returning personal enrichment classes for members of the community with interests in arts and crafts, cooking, dance, fitness, gardening, personal finance, volunteering, writing or finding a new way to express creativity.

Classes will be beginning the first week of February. To register or for more information on any of the courses, visit www.lewistonadulted.org or call 795-4141.
